MEMO — Heads of Department

Quick heads-up: we're overhauling the Sunspoke Rewards programme starting next quarter. Points will convert to the new tier system automatically, and the old punch-card scheme at the Fernleigh branches gets retired for good. Marketing has the comms drafted; ops, please flag any till-system snags by Thursday. Keep this quiet until the all-hands, since it ties into what's outlined just below.

management briefing: Project Ulavan slips by two quarters because of the staffing delay.

**Ticket SCRUB-REVIEW — needs sign-off at weekly sync**

Quick one for the eng sync: the EXIF scrubbing pass for uploads on Pineglass is done and sitting in review. It strips GPS, device serials, and timestamps from every image before it hits the CDN, with a quarantine path for files the parser chokes on. Perf hit is about 40ms per image, which we think is fine. We just need someone with authority to bless the quarantine retention policy before we ship. Sign-off owner is named below.

approver of yawig-yajef = Briius Jorix

TURN-208: Gatevale turnstile counters at the Merrow Field pilot double-count when a rotation reverses mid-cycle. Attendance totals drift roughly 2% high per event. The debounce window fix is implemented, reviewed by Ilsa, and soak-tested across two simulated match days without drift. Ready for your cut; the candidate build is identified below.

trace token, tagag-tafog: htk6_5ed18c

# FX Hedging Decision — Managers Only (Tervane Group)

Welcome aboard — here's the short version for the incoming director. Last quarter we decided to hedge roughly 70% of our exposure to the larn, since most Pellwick contracts settle in it and swings were eating our margins. Finance ran three scenarios; the forward-contract route won on cost and simplicity. Rolf Ansdell owns the program and rebalances monthly. It's working so far. How this ties into broader plans is noted directly below.

board note of bawep-tajef: Queniusek Systems plans to raise the Quenvan list price by 53.1 percent in March. The pricing group signed off on a budget of $176.4 million for Project Drueth. The renewal with Casionix Partners closes at $142.5 million a year, 8.3 percent below the last contract. Project Fraax slips by six weeks because of the tooling delay.